Vasquez entered their tilt with Faith Baptist on Wednesday with six consecutive wins, and they'll enter their next game with seven. They were the clear victors by a 13-6 margin over the Contenders. The result was nothing new for the Mustangs, who have now won 11 matchups by six runs or more so far this season.
Luke Real made a big impact no matter where he played. On the mound, he didn't allow a single earned run while striking out eight over five innings pitched. He has been nothing but reliable: he hasn't given up a single earned run in five consecutive appearances. He was also big at the plate, going 2-for-4 with one stolen base and one run.
In other batting news, Landon McGriff was incredible, getting on base in four of his five plate appearances with two stolen bases, two runs, and two RBI. That's the most stolen bases he has posted since back in March of 2024. Zach Vanornum was another key player, getting on base in all four of his plate appearances with two stolen bases and two runs.
Vasquez kept the outfield on their toes and finished the game with 12 hits.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now got at least eight hits in three consecutive games.
Vasquez pushed their record up to 17-4 with the victory, which was their third straight on the road. Those road wins came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 2.7 runs on average over those games. As for Faith Baptist, they are on a nine-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-12.
Vasquez has already played their next contest, a 5-4 loss against Palmdale on the 3rd. As for Faith Baptist, they also did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next match, a 10-7 defeat against Pacifica Christian/Santa Monica on the 5th.
